Auto-create Orderry work orders or leads from a website intake form via the API.

Steps
Review the field types/restrictions on the target work order or lead form in Orderry (Settings) before mapping website form fields to it.
Match each website field's data type (e.g. numeric-only 'House number') to Orderry's configured field type to avoid submission errors.
Submit the mapped data via the documented API method for creating leads or work orders.
Handle and surface API validation errors back to the website form rather than silently dropping failed submissions.
Confirm the created record lands in the expected pipeline/status for staff to action.
Known gotchas
A type mismatch (e.g. a customer entering a letter in a numeric-only field) causes work order/lead creation to fail rather than partially succeed — validate client-side too.
Products/stock are not automatically written off when a sale originates from a website — inventory sync for e-commerce-originated orders needs separate handling.
